(Photo by … Web14 feb 2024 · Cocaine: Penalties for cocaine trafficking (depending on the amount) can involve prison time between 3-15 years as well as fines of up to $250,000. Heroin: In cases of heroin trafficking (depending on the amount), a defendant can face up to 25 years in prison and fines of up to $500,000. Web2 giu 2024 · Most of the time, probation lasts one year, but it can also be as many as three or more. 3. Fines. One of the ways Congress and state governments use to discourage drug trafficking is by issuing hefty fines. For state charges, you may face fines in the range of $25,000 to $100,000, and possibly higher. WebJail time calculations are extremely important because they affect release dates for all inmates in both State and local correctional facilities. Jail time records are required to be kept by each sheriff pursuant to Correction Law '600-a.
